What happened
The India-bound LPG tanker MV Sunshine is safely navigating the Strait of Hormuz, a critical maritime choke point, with the assistance of the Indian Navy. This ensures the uninterrupted flow of vital energy supplies to India.
Why it matters
The Strait of Hormuz is a geopolitically sensitive region, and safe passage for energy shipments is crucial for India's energy security and economic stability. This news alleviates immediate concerns about supply disruptions and potential spikes in energy prices.
Impact on Indian markets
While no specific stocks are named, this development is broadly positive for Indian companies reliant on imported energy, particularly in the oil & gas sector. It reduces a potential risk factor for the broader economy and logistics companies involved in energy transport.
What traders should watch next
Traders should continue to monitor geopolitical developments in the Middle East, as any escalation could quickly reverse this positive sentiment. Also, watch for any long-term strategies India might implement to further diversify its energy supply routes.
